Global Landscape of PE Plastic Toy Masterbatch Manufacturing

Navigating regulatory convergence, safety standard evolutions, and polymer carrier chemistry in modern pediatric plastic goods production.

The global market for polyolefin toy masterbatches is undergoing a structural paradigm shift driven by stringent regulatory frameworks, eco-conscious consumer behavior, and advanced polymers processing requirements. As pediatric products come into direct cutaneous and oral contact with infants and young children, selecting qualified custom PE plastic toy masterbatch companies & suppliers is no longer merely a visual design choice—it is a mission-critical safety and compliance mandate.

Polyethylene (PE), spanning Low-Density Polyethylene (LDPE), Linear Low-Density Polyethylene (LLDPE), and High-Density Polyethylene (HDPE), accounts for over 45% of all synthetic polymers used in global toy manufacturing. From blow-molded hollow beach toys and outdoor play structures to high-precision injection-molded building blocks and action figures, PE resin requires specialized pigment masterbatches engineered with pristine carrier resin compatibility, zero heavy-metal leaching, and exceptional thermal stability during extrusion.

Key Engineering Takeaway: Unlike generic industrial color concentrates, toy-grade PE masterbatches must utilize virgin LLDPE/HDPE carrier matrices with Melt Flow Index (MFI) tailored exactly to the target molding application ($12\text{--}30\text{ g/10min}$ for injection molding; $0.5\text{--}4\text{ g/10min}$ for blow molding and extrusion). Using mismatched carrier resins leads to phase separation, surface blooming, stress cracking, and non-compliance with EN71-3 migration limits.

Leading global brands operating across North America, the European Union, East Asia, and South America now require color concentrate suppliers to deliver full supply chain transparency. Sourcing teams must audit pigment suppliers against a complex web of international chemical safety standards, including EU EN71-3:2019+A1:2021 (Migration of Certain Elements), ASTM F963-17 (Standard Consumer Safety Specification for Toy Safety), US CPSIA (Total Lead and Phthalates content), REACH SVHC Candidate List, and China GB 6675 series.

Technical Architecture: Micro-Dispersion & Safety Engineering

Understanding the molecular dynamics, dispersion physics, and chemical safety controls behind premium polyolefin masterbatches.

Sub-Micron Particle Dispersion

Using multi-stage co-rotating twin-screw extruders and specialized dispersants, pigment agglomerates are broken down below $1.5\ \mu\text{m}$. This eliminates color streaking, pinholes in thin-walled toys, and structural micro-cracks.

Zero Non-Migration Organic Pigments

Formulated exclusively with non-bleeding, non-migratory organic pigments and food-contact approved inorganic complexes. Prevents color transfer under saliva contact or prolonged friction during active play.

High Heat & Thermal Resistance

Withstanding processing temperatures up to 260°C without color fading, gas generation, or polymer backbone degradation. Ideal for rapid multi-cavity injection molding cycles.

Localized Application Scenarios in Toy Processing

Tailored masterbatch formulation matrices optimized for blow molding, injection molding, profile extrusion, and infant oral-contact components.

Blow Molded Hollow Toys

Products: Beach buckets, outdoor playhouses, blow-molded ride-on vehicles, hollow balls.
Requirements: Superior melt strength, non-sagging parison behavior, excellent environmental stress crack resistance (ESCR), and vivid UV weatherability for outdoor sunlight resistance.

Injection Molded Building Blocks

Products: Interlocking bricks, educational puzzles, action figures, mini action figurines.
Requirements: Ultra-precise color consistency ($\Delta E < 0.3$), zero dimensional shrinkage distortion, high gloss finish, and high tinting strength at low addition ratios (1% - 3%).

Infant Oral-Contact & Bath Toys

Products: Baby teethers, flexible squeeze bath animals, rattle handles.
Requirements: Strict food-contact safety compliance (FDA 21 CFR 177.1520), heavy-metal-free, odor-free, low volatile organic compound (VOC) emissions, and extreme extraction fastness.

Future Trends: Sustainable & Smart Masterbatch Innovations

How next-generation color concentrates are adapting to circular economy targets, bio-based polymers, and intelligent functional additives.

The plastic toy sector is under escalating pressure to reduce its carbon footprint and transition toward sustainable end-of-life recycling. Leading custom PE plastic toy masterbatch manufacturers are pioneering forward-looking technical innovations to meet global sustainability directives:

1. Bio-Based PE Carrier Concentrates

Transitioning from fossil-fuel LLDPE to bio-based polyethylene derived from sugarcane ethanol. Bio-PE masterbatches exhibit identical physical, mechanical, and colorimetric properties while reducing total product lifecycle carbon emissions by up to 70%.

2. NIR-Detectable Black Masterbatches for Circular Recycling

Traditional black plastic toys colored with carbon black pigment absorb near-infrared (NIR) radiation, making them invisible to automated optical sorting sensors in recycling facilities. Advanced NIR-detectable black masterbatches utilize specialty organic black dyes, enabling automated sorting streams to successfully identify and recycle PE toys into high-purity post-consumer recycled (PCR) resin.

3. Antimicrobial & Anti-Static Functional Masterbatches

Post-pandemic health concerns have accelerated the demand for multi-functional masterbatches. Integrating silver-ion antimicrobial additives into color concentrates inhibits 99.9% of surface bacterial growth on pediatric toys, while permanent anti-static additives prevent dust accumulation on retail shelves and domestic play environments.

Enterprise Purchasing & Supplier Vetting Checklist

A structured technical audit guide for procurement directors, polymer engineers, and quality assurance managers.

Evaluating potential supplier partners requires a systematic audit framework covering raw material integrity, laboratory capabilities, and international compliance documentation. Sourcing managers should verify the following five critical benchmarks prior to issuing purchase orders:

1. Carrier Resin Verification

Confirm that the masterbatch carrier polymer matches your base resin (e.g., LLDPE carrier for LLDPE/HDPE molding). Demand certification that no off-spec or unwashed recycled content is blended into toy-grade lines.

2. Comprehensive Heavy-Metal Testing

Require third-party test reports (SGS, TUV, Intertek) verifying compliance with EN71-3 19 soluble element migration limits, CPSIA lead limits (< 90 ppm), and phthalate restrictions.

3. Spectrophotometric Color Matching

Verify that the factory utilizes computer color matching software and dual illuminant testing (D65 daylight and TL84/F11 store lighting) to eliminate metamerism issues.

Frequently Asked Questions (FAQ)

Expert technical responses to common questions raised by polymer engineers, plastic toy factory owners, and procurement specialists.

Q1: What makes PE masterbatch specifically safe for children's toy manufacturing?
Toy-grade PE masterbatches are formulated exclusively with virgin PE carrier resins and organic pigments certified free of heavy metals (lead, cadmium, mercury, hexavalent chromium), toxic phthalates, aromatic amines, and halogenated flame retardants. They comply strictly with EU EN71-3, US CPSIA, and ASTM F963 international standards.
Q2: Why is matching the carrier resin Melt Flow Index (MFI) critical for toy injection molding?
If the masterbatch carrier resin has a significantly lower MFI than the base polymer, incomplete dispersion occurs, resulting in color streaks, internal stress concentrations, and brittle fracture points on molded toys. Matching or slightly exceeding the base resin MFI ensures homogenously distributed pigment without altering mechanical strength.

Q4: Can PE color masterbatch be used in blow-molded hollow toys like beach buckets?
Yes. Our specialized blow-molding grade masterbatches utilize low-MFI LLDPE/HDPE carrier matrices ($0.5\text{--}2.0\text{ g/10min}$) designed to maintain parison melt strength, prevent wall-thickness variation, and resist environmental stress cracking (ESCR).
Q5: What is the recommended addition ratio (let-down ratio) for toy masterbatches?
Because our high-concentration masterbatches feature pigment loadings up to 40% - 70%, the standard let-down ratio ranges between 1% and 4% by weight, depending on target opacity, wall thickness, and color intensity.
Q6: Does your masterbatch cause pigment migration or surface blooming under friction?
No. We strictly select high-molecular-weight organic pigments with high solvent and sweat fastness (Grade 5). Pigments are locked chemically into the PE polymer matrix, preventing bleeding during oral or cutaneous contact.
